Maison  >  Article  >  Tutoriel système  >  Introduction à la commande de redémarrage sous Linux

Introduction à la commande de redémarrage sous Linux

王林
王林original
2024-02-22 18:21:03687parcourir

Introduction et exemples de code de commande de redémarrage sous Linux

Titre : Introduction et exemples de commande de redémarrage sous Linux

Introduction :
Dans le système Linux, le redémarrage est une commande très importante, qui est utilisée pour redémarrer le système. Que ce soit sur un serveur ou un ordinateur personnel, la commande reboot est indispensable. Cet article présentera aux lecteurs l'utilisation de la commande reboot et les exemples de code associés.

1. Présentation de la commande reboot
La commande reboot est utilisée pour redémarrer le système d'exploitation Linux. Lorsque nous devons mettre à jour le noyau ou les fichiers de configuration, ou lorsqu'il y a un problème avec le système, la commande reboot nous permet de redémarrer le système en toute sécurité et de le restaurer à son état normal.

2. Syntaxe de la commande reboot
La syntaxe de base de la commande reboot est la suivante :

reboot [选项]

Options communes :

  • -f : Forcer le redémarrage, aucune confirmation requise. -f:强制重启,无需确认。
  • -n:避免运行shutdown脚本。
  • -w
  • -n : évitez d'exécuter des scripts d'arrêt.

-w : remplace uniquement le fichier du logo de démarrage et ne redémarre pas réellement.

  1. 3. Exemples de commande de redémarrage


    Redémarrage de base

    Le moyen le plus simple de redémarrer est d'utiliser la commande de redémarrage directement sans aucune option.
  2. reboot
  3. Le système effectuera automatiquement un redémarrage et reviendra à la phase de démarrage du système d'exploitation.


    Forcer le redémarrage

    Si le système contient actuellement des données non enregistrées ou si un programme est en cours d'exécution, le système invitera l'utilisateur à enregistrer les données et à fermer le programme. Mais si vous êtes sûr d'avoir enregistré toutes les données ou que vous ne pouvez pas le faire manuellement, vous pouvez utiliser l'option de redémarrage forcé. L'option
  4. reboot -f
  5. -f forcera le redémarrage du système et ignorera les tâches inachevées.


    Fermez tous les programmes puis redémarrez

    Vous pouvez utiliser la commande shutdown pour redémarrer le système après un certain temps et fermer tous les programmes en cours d'exécution pendant cette période. Tout d'abord, définissez l'heure de redémarrage à l'aide de la commande suivante :

    shutdown -r +5

    La commande ci-dessus entraînera le redémarrage du système après 5 minutes. Ensuite, utilisez la commande reboot pour redémarrer immédiatement :
  6. reboot -f
  7. De cette façon, le système fermera tous les programmes en toute sécurité et redémarrera après 5 minutes.


    N'exécutez aucune commande après le redémarrage

    Parfois, nous souhaitons simplement redémarrer le système sans exécuter aucune commande. Vous pouvez utiliser la commande suivante :
  8. reboot -n
  9. Le système redémarrera mais n'entrera pas dans le script d'arrêt.


    Remplacer le fichier du logo de démarrage

    Parfois, nous souhaitons simplement remplacer le fichier du logo de démarrage sans redémarrer le système. Vous pouvez utiliser la commande suivante :
  10. reboot -w
De cette façon, le système mettra à jour le fichier du logo de démarrage, mais il ne redémarrera pas réellement.


🎜Conclusion : 🎜Cet article présente aux lecteurs l'importante commande de redémarrage dans les systèmes Linux, ainsi que les exemples d'utilisation et de code de cette commande. En utilisant correctement la commande reboot, nous pouvons revenir à la normale lorsqu'un problème système survient, ou redémarrer le système lorsque le noyau ou les fichiers de configuration doivent être mis à jour. J'espère que cet article pourra être utile aux lecteurs dans le domaine de la gestion et de la maintenance du système Linux. 🎜

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n